John Habersham Esq.
Savannah Georgia
Accountants Office
June 12th 1798
Sir
You will receive from the Treasurer of the United States the sum of three thousand seven hundred & seventy dollars on account of the pay of the Troops in Georgia for January & February 1798 & for which you will be held accountable —
Sam &c
W Simmons
Acct

Mr Samuel Vincent
Baltimore
Accountants Office
June 12th 1798
Sir
I wrote you on the 24th April last enclosing a statement of your account current, to which I requested your attention— and have not heard from you on the subject I have to renew the application & hope you will immediately comply therewith, expecting an answer
I remain &c W[undecipherable]
